Avokado for Twitter Extension
By simply adding Avokado to your browser, a sleek and user-friendly emoji reaction toolbar appears alongside each tweet in your Twitter timeline. This toolbar offers a wide range of expressive emojis, enabling you to effortlessly convey your emotions and thoughts about a tweet with a single click. Whether you want to express joy, laughter, surprise, love, or any other sentiment, Avokado's extensive emoji library ensures you'll find the perfect reaction for every tweet.

Method 2: Download Avokado for Twitter extension for Chrome and install in Developer Mode
This is another method to install Avokado for Twitter extension manually, but the twist is that here, you install by enabling the developer mode option provided in Google Chrome. This mode is commonly used for testing extensions or running unpublished tools.
Step 1: Download the Avokado for Twitter extension file
Select and download the Avokado for Twitter extension by clicking the 'Download CRX' button on the website.
Step 2: Extract the downloaded contents
Convert the file to a ZIP file if it is in CRX format then extract the Avokado for Twitter extension zip file or folder that you downloaded. Make sure you extract it using the same folder name and keep it safely in another folder, so you don't delete it by mistake. The extracted folder will be needed to keep your Avokado for Twitter extension running.
Step 3: Open Chrome Extension Setting Page
In the address bar of Google Chrome, type chrome://extensions and open the Chrome Extension Page.
Step 4: Enable Developer Mode
After opening the Chrome Extension page, look at the top right side, and you will find the toggle option of "Developer mode."Simply enable that developer mode option.
Step 5: Load the Unpacked Extension
Once you enable the developer mode option, you will see the menu of Load Unpacked, Pack Extensions and Update. From that, select the option "Load unpacked."
Step 6: Select the Extension Folder
Once the pop-up opens upon clicking Load unpacked, select the Avokado for Twitter extension directory and click on the "Select Folder "button.
Step 7: Confirm and Install
After you select an extension folder of a Google Chrome extension you're installing manually, confirm its installation for the final time and let the installation complete.
